I'd "upgraded" from the Pixel 6 Pro to the Galaxy S23 Ultra and, since the 6.x.x series of updates (along with the recent "OneUI 6.0 update") found that the Galaxy S23 Ultra simply could not keep a connect with the MME - no matter if wired or wireless. The only thing that I did not test was simply turning off the Wireless Projection function and just run AA in pure wired mode (this disables all AA Wireless functions -- very important since plugging your phone into the USB port in the car does not force the AA connection to run in wired only mode if the "Wireless Projection" setting is not disabled on the Mach-E). I would not expect this to be any better, though, so be ready for that.

Otherwise, I'd recommend grabbing a Pixel 7a or 8 and give that a try. I used the recent sale on the Pixel 8 Pro to trade in my P6P (which I kept since Samsung wasn't offering trade value on it to get me to swap it out) for a reasonable price. The P8P has been reliable with its connection to my car, leaving me to blame Samsung for the issue.

I have the Samsung S23 Ultra with the latest Android release 16.0. I have had no problems using PAAK on it since I took delivery in 2022, including moving from an older Samsung phone to this one. I just had to have my APIM replaced, and the dealer reloaded a lot of the firmware. I followed the directions to reinstate my phone that VSGURU gave above, and everything is working perfectly. Note that I utilize Android Auto and see the MME Wi-Fi as well as Bluetooth in use. Note, I haven't had any problem with Google Maps recently, did have some last year and used Waze for awhile.

I'm having intermittent issues with Android Auto: My wife's phone connects all the time, but mine fails on occasion. I thought I had to stop the car, get out, get in and try again (LOLITA), but that was not reliable, either. Now I delete my phone from the Mach-E configuration, then add it back; so far this seems to work. Note that the dealer recently upgrades all the software/firmware, but the issue persists. OH: I found out that my wife's phone is the "primary" owner on Ford Pass. Perhaps that's where the glitch is.
